Sky Sports: Leeds also interested in Euro 2024 attacker alongside Ramazani

After seeing their attack picked apart by Premier League interest this summer, Leeds United have reportedly reignited their interest in signing a Bundesliga star for Daniel Farke.

Leeds transfer news

The Whites find themselves in a fairly frantic position in the final days of the transfer window, having lost Crysencio Summerville, Archie Gray, Glen Kamara and, most recently, Georginio Rutter. The attacking midfielder completed his move to Brighton & Hove Albion to leave the side that helped Leeds reach last season's playoff final in tatters.

That said, as Transfermarkt have highlighted, those at Elland Road now have plenty of money to spend on reinforcements, which could reportedly see the likes of Manuel Benson and Largie Ramazani arrive to hand Farke some much-needed attacking additions.

According to Fabrizio Romano, the Yorkshire club have reportedly reached an agreement to sign Ramazani from Almeria, with the winger set to undergo a medical before joining up with his new teammates and potentially another winger at Elland Road as soon as possible.

According to Graham Smyth of The Yorkshire Evening Post via Leeds All Over and Sky Sports' Tim Thornton, Leeds have reignited their interest in signing Roland Sallai after seeing their initial attempts knocked back by Freiburg earlier this summer. The Bundesliga club's stance has now reportedly changed, however, and the 27-year-old has become more attainable.

Of course, some will remember Sallai from the heartbreak he helped to inflict on Scotland at Euro 2024, assisting Kevin Csoboth's last-gasp winner to knock Steve Clarke's side out and give Hungary hope that eventually failed to turn into qualification out of Group A.

Alas, with just over a week left in the summer transfer window, Leeds will have to act fast if they want to secure the winger's signature.

"Determined" Sallai could replace Summerville

Replacing Summerville is no easy task. He is a player of Premier League quality, as he will likely show this season at West Ham United. But, Sallai is one of the candidates who should, on paper, slot straight into his role and thrive under Farke, especially when dropping down from the Bundesliga.

Roland Sallai for Hungary.

The 26-year-old has impressed in Germany's top flight, stealing the show for Freiburg at times, with eight goals and four assists in all competitions last season. Described as "determined" by former Freiburg manager Christian Streich, Sallai could now get the chance to pick up where he left off in an impressive Euro 2024 in the Championship this season.

Compared to Benson and Forbs, Sallai certainly has more experience at the top level, featuring in the Europa League last season. Of course, that means that his signature could come at a certain price, but Frieburg's reported change of stance may just open the door for Leeds to secure a cheaper deal.

If it is to be the Hungarian with Ramazani, then Sallai will be one to watch this season.

Kane Williamson awarded Sir Richard Hadlee medal for fourth time

Amelia Kerr, Devon Conway also pick up top honours at the New Zealand Cricket Awards

ESPNcricinfo staff13-Apr-2021

Kane Williamson scored a career-best 251 against West Indies in Hamilton•Getty Images

New Zealand captain Kane Williamson has been awarded the Sir Richard Hadlee medal for the fourth time in six years, while women’s allrounder Amelia Kerr and rising star Devon Conway also claimed top honours at the New Zealand Cricket Awards for the 2020-21 season.Williamson was given the award on the back of his impressive run in Tests during the summer, where he scored a career-best 251 against the West Indies in Hamilton, followed by a century on his home ground in Tauranga during the Boxing Day Test. He also made a double-century against Pakistan in Christchurch, which helped New Zealand book their place in the ICC World Test Championship final. Overall, New Zealand won 17 out of 20 matches they played during the summer, and claimed all seven series.Related

Williamson, the highest ranked Test batsman, was also named the International Test Player of the Year and awarded the Redpath Cup for first-class batting, after he amassed 639 runs in just four innings at an average of 159.”Going into the Test summer – there was that Championship final carrot and there was a real drive there for the guys,” Williamson told Richard Hadlee on a phone call, upon receiving the news of the award. “Although it seemed a long way off, winning four Tests before you’ve started one is a pretty lofty goal. To spend some time at the crease personally and make contributions towards that … certainly proud as a leader and a player in this side that we were able to achieve some of those things and we’re looking forward to that final.”In the women’s category, Kerr won the Super Smash and the International T20 awards. The legspinning allrounder played a key role in the White Ferns’ wins over Australia in Brisbane last December and in Napier last month. She averaged 51 with the bat, striking at 134 in the Super Smash T20s. She also took 14 wickets, including a hat-trick for Wellington Blaze in the final.Conway, meanwhile, was named the men’s player of the year in both ODIs as well as T20Is. He had smashed 473 T20I runs at a strike rate of 151 during the season, including four half-centuries, to edge out Glenn Phillips (366 runs at 40.6) and bowlers Tim Southee (21 wickets at 16.7) and Ish Sodhi (20 wickets at 15.4) for the award. He was equally dominant in the ODIs, hitting 225 runs, including his maiden century, in the three-match series against Bangladesh in March.Finn Allen, the 21-year-old opener who recently made his international debut, was named the Super Smash Player of the Year in the men’s category after scoring 512 runs at an average of 56 and a strike-rate of 193.Kyle Jamieson, a key member of New Zealand’s Test attack, was given the Windsor Cup for first-class bowling, his first NZC award. Jamieson had picked up 27 wickets during the season, including a haul of 11 in the final Test against Pakistan in Christchurch. In the Plunket Shield, he picked up 20 wickets in just three matches for Auckland, including a hat-trick at Eden Park Outer Oval.Stand-in captain Amy Satterthwaite was named the women’s ODI Player of the Year, courtesy 304 runs in six matches on her comeback trail.Former batsman Jeff Crowe was honoured with the Bert Sutcliffe Medal for outstanding services to cricket. Crowe represented New Zealand in 39 Tests and 75 ODIs between 1983 and 1990, captaining the side on 22 occasions. He was later appointed manager of the national team. Since 2004, Crowe has been an ICC match referee, overseeing 103 Tests, 301 ODIs and 137 T20s.

São Paulo pode receber bolada por jovens de Cotia em 2022; veja o valor

MatériaMais Notícias

O São Paulo pode receber uma boa quantia em 2022 por conta de jogadores criados na base. Tratam-se dos atacantes Paulinho Boia e Helinho, que possuem negócios encaminhados com outras equipes para a próxima temporada.

Boia, emprestado ao Juventude, despertou o interesse do Metalist-UCR, que está disposto a pagar cerca de1,8 milhões de euros (cerca de R$ 11,6 milhões, na cotação atual).Caso a negociação seja fechada nesse valor, o Tricolor teria direito a cerca de R$ 10,4 milhões que corresponde a 90% do montante. Vale lembrar que ele já se despediu do Juventude e vai fazer exames na Ucrânia.

Pelo São Paulo, Boia disputou 31 partidas desde que subiu aos profissionais, com um gol marcado, na vitória sobre o Guarani por 3 a 1, pelo Paulistão de 2020. Em 30 partidas, são nove vitórias, 10 empates e 11 derrotas em sua passagem pelo Tricolor até o momento.

Já Helinho tem a sua situação praticamente definida. Emprestado ao Red Bull Bragantino, o atacante de 21 anos deve ser comprado pela equipe de Bragança Paulista, que inclusive já até comunicou sua intenção de ficar com o jogador ao São Paulo.

A cláusula de compra gira em torno de R$ 23 milhões, com o São Paulo possuindo ainda 20% de uma futura vendo do jogador.Helinho foi revelado pelo São Paulo em novembro de 2018, estreando com gol no empate diante do Flamengo por 2 a 2. No entanto, ele acabou perdendo espaço e foi emprestado ao Red Bul Bragantino.

Sendo assim, o Tricolor pode embolsar cerca de R$ 33,4 milhões com a venda dos dois jogadores. Dinheiro importante para sanar algumas dívidas já pendentes para o ano que vem, como os pagamentos de Daniel Alves e Hernanes e a maior parte do salário de Calleri e Rigoni.

Kane Williamson replaces David Warner as Sunrisers Hyderabad captain

The franchise also announced there will be a change in their overseas combination for their match on Sunday

ESPNcricinfo staff01-May-2021

David Warner and Kane Williamson run between the wickets•AFP

Kane Williamson will take over the Sunrisers Hyderabad’s captaincy from David Warner for the remainder of IPL 2021. The franchise has also announced there will be a change in their overseas combination for the match against the Rajasthan Royals on Sunday.Williamson’s promotion comes a day after Warner said he took “full responsibility” for the Sunrisers’ loss against the Chennai Super Kings, their fifth defeat in six games. A game prior to that he had described Manish Pandey’s omission from the starting XI as a “harsh” call by the “selectors”.Although he scored a half-century, Warner appeared a very frustrated figure while he batted in that match, unhappy with both his timing and the way he kept finding the Super Kings fielders instead of the gaps. Sunrisers somehow made it to 171 for 3 thanks to a fifty from Manish Pandey as well and some clever finishing from Williamson (26 off 10). But it did not prove anywhere near a competitive total.”I take full responsibility. The way that I batted was obviously very slow,” Warner told host broadcaster after the Sunrisers lost to the Super Kings by seven wickets. “I was hitting a lot of fielders and [was] very, very frustrated… Look I take full responsibility from a batting point of view. I felt [that with] Manish coming back into the team, the way that he batted was exceptional. And obviously Kane [Williamson] and Kedar [Jadhav] towards the back end there, they put some boundaries away and got us to a respectable total. I felt that we were probably just below par from where we were. But yeah look, at the end of the day, I’ll take full responsibility.”Williamson had captained the Sunrisers in the 2018 season when Warner was barred from the IPL for his involvement in the Newlands ball-tampering scandal. He topped the run-scorers’ chart back then with a tally of 735 in 17 matches and led the team to its second IPL final in history. Overall, Williamson’s captaincy record in the IPL reads 14 wins and 12 losses in 26 matches.Warner had a similar effect on the team when they won the IPL in 2016. He was their leading batter (848 runs in 17 matches) and has been one of the most consistent overseas performers in the tournament’s history.”The decision has not come lightly as the management respects the enormous impact David Warner has had for the franchise over a number of years,” the Sunrisers statement said announcing the captaincy change said. “As we face the remainder of the season, we are sure David will continue to help us strive for success both on and off the field.”Although the franchise hasn’t mentioned anything officially, it is possible Warner might not be part of their match tomorrow.

رسميًا | بايرن ميونخ يعلن تمديد عقد مانويل نوير حتى 2026

أعلن نادي بايرن ميونخ الألماني، تمديد عقد حارسه وقائده مانويل نوير، حتى يونيو 2026، ليستمر للعام الـ15 على التوالي مدافعًا عن ألوان العملاق البافاري.

مانويل نوير انضم إلى بايرن ميونخ في صيف 2011 قادمًا من شالكة، وأصبح قائدًا للفريق في عام 2017، وقاد الفريق للفوز بالعديد من البطولات، مثل ثلاثية الدوري الألماني وكأس ألمانيا ودوري أبطال أوروبا مرتين، في 2013 و2020.

وتوّج الحارس الألماني ببطولة كأس العالم للأندية والسوبر الأوروبي في كلا العامين.

فاز نوير بالدوري الألماني 11 مرة وكأس ألمانيا 6 مرات وكأس السوبر الألماني 7 مرات، مع خوضه 547 مباراة بألوان الأحمر البافاري.

وعلى مستوى المنتخب الألماني، توّج نوير ببطولة كأس العالم عام 2014، قبل أن يعتزل دوليًا بعد يورو 2024 التي أقيمت في ألمانيا الصيف الماضي، حيث خاض 124 مباراة دولية.

وصرّح نوير بعد تمديد عقده: “أستمتع حقًا بكرة القدم وأريد أن أستمر مع بايرن ميونخ، أشعر بالشغف دائمًا في النادي، وأتطلع إلى عام آخر لتحقيق البطولات. لقد أجرينا محادثات إيجابية ولم أتردد في الموافقة على الاستمرار مع هذا النادي العملاق”.

Why Arteta pulled plug on Arsenal signing Ivan Toney

Another number nine they were heavily linked with, and for a long time before his move to Al-Ahli, was Ivan Toney. Some reports claimed Arsenal were planning a late summer bid to sign Toney, but the transfer didn't come to fruition. Journalist Miguel Delaney of The Independent, writing an inside story this week, has explained exactly why.

According to the reporter, Arteta personally pulled the plug on an Arsenal move for Toney in the summer, with the Spaniard believing that he wouldn't have fit in with the group and there was little potential for chemistry with his current squad.

The England striker ultimately made a deadline day switch to Saudi Arabia, despite late rumoured interest from Chelsea, and is now on a lucrative mega-money contract of around £330,000-per-week. It was a bizarre end to the Toney transfer saga at Brentford, which had been going on for nearly a year, but Thomas Frank insists that he remains a Bees "legend".

“On the pitch, he has been a fantastic goalscorer, link-up player and leader. He has pushed the team, the squad and himself," said Frank on Toney's move to Al-Ahli.

“It’s a wonderful journey that we have been on together. Ivan helped the club and the team, and the club and the team have helped Ivan.

“I’m happy he has an opportunity to try something new in his life and career. We thank him for so many magic moments and wish him all the best for his next chapter. Ivan leaves as a Brentford legend.”

BCCI's top brass in UAE: IPL, T20 World Cup on the agenda

Discussions to be held on IPL bio-bubble norms, crowds, and hosting of the ICC event among other things

Nagraj Gollapudi31-May-2021

BCCI’s top brass are currently in the UAE•Getty Images

The BCCI’s top brass, led by board secretary Jay Shah, reached Dubai via a charter flight on Monday to finalise plans for the remainder of IPL 2021 as well as discuss the probability of the UAE hosting the men’s T20 World Cup this October-November. BCCI president Sourav Ganguly will reach Dubai on Wednesday to join talks with the Emirates Cricket Board (ECB).Shah’s contingent comprises Arun Dhumal (board treasurer), Brijesh Patel (IPL governing council chairman), Jayesh George (board joint-secretary), Hemang Amin (BCCI’s interim chief executive officer) and Dhiraj Malhotra (BCCI’ general manager of operations and tournament director for T20 World Cup).On Saturday, the BCCI was authorised by its members – the state associations – to shift the second half of the IPL to the UAE in September-October after the tournament was abruptly and indefinitely suspended in the first week of May. The BCCI had been forced to pull the plug at the halfway stage due to the growing number of Covid-19 cases in the bubble during the Ahmedabad and Delhi leg of the tournament. A total of 31 matches, including four playoffs, remain to be played.In its talks with the ECB, the BCCI is expected to firstly get the approval of the UAE government to host the IPL there. The discussions are also likely to go into the preparedness of the three UAE venues – Dubai, Abu Dhabi and Sharjah – and the mandatory requirements for creating the tournament bubble for the eight IPL teams.With players arriving from different parts of the world, and not just India, both boards would need to look at the quarantine requirements that need to be satisfied before the BCCI finalises the standard operating procedures (SOPs) for the IPL.One other significant point likely to be discussed is around the vaccination for all those that would be part of the IPL bubble. Recently, the Abu Dhabi government approved the hosting of the remainder of PSL 2021 in the emirate on the condition that all six teams and rest of the stakeholders that will be part of the tournament bubble are vaccinated.Sourav Ganguly is expected to reach Dubai on Wednesday for meetings with the Emirates Cricket Board•International Cricket Council

T20 World Cup moving to the UAE?
The presence of the entire top wing of the BCCI in Dubai can be seen as a first move by the BCCI to shift the T20 World Cup to the UAE, which had been named as a cover for India. The ICC has not yet announced the final itinerary for the the 16-team World Cup.While India are currently slated as hosts for the event, the state of the Covid-19 pandemic in the country and the suspension of the IPL has triggered strong doubts over the country’s readiness.At the BCCI’s SGM on Saturday, Ganguly told the members that the BCCI would seek another month’s time to finalise whether India could host the T20 World Cup.One key point the BCCI team is likely to discuss with the ECB would concern the revenue-sharing arrangement for the tournament should it be hosted in the UAE. Recently Malhotra had said on a BBC podcast that while moving the T20 World Cup to the UAE will be the “worst-case scenario”, the BCCI will still want to retain the hosting rights.The main reason for that is the lucrative sum involved: every match in an ICC global event is worth about USD 250,000-300,000 for the hosting board. With 45 matches, that is a massive amount of money.The other point for discussion would be, if the UAE ends up hosting both the IPL and T20 World Cup, can the venues handle two back-to-back marquee events and the fitness of the pitches in such a scenario. A total of 76 matches will be lined up for the venues if both the IPL and the T20 World Cup are played there, excluding the warm-up matches for the latter.Both boards will also want to consider the prospect of opening up the IPL to crowds. In 2020, when the entire IPL was hosted in the UAE, the BCCI had opted not to allow crowds in. The upcoming PSL in Abu Dhabi, it has been confirmed, will also be played out behind closed doors.
